Rumble Inc - Ordinary Shares - Class A

:CFVI   12:58:53 AM EDT
6.94
0.00 (0.00%)
12:59:59 AM EDT: $6.95 +0.01 (+0.07%)
Twitter Share  Facebook Share StockTwits Share